Content producer, presenter, founding member and former music editor of gal-dem, Antonia Odunlami will be showcasing talents from young Afro-Caribbean creative diasporans that include music artists, playwrights, actors, entrepreneurs. This show aims to build a space to celebrate the diversity and to champion different styles and approaches creatives can have while still being a part of the diaspora.
Antonia is joined by Akinola Davies for a chat and Kensaye for a guest mix.
Director and moving image artist Akinola Davies Jr. aka Crack Stevens talks about his visual work with the likes of Blood Orange (Charcoal Baby), Klein (Marks of Worship) and first US solo exhibition H.O.D (Heroes of Displacement)which explores the reclamation of African artefacts through the west via ritual.
French DJ and producer Kensaye delivers a guest mix that blends all the elements of his sound which spans the globe.
